To implement a decomposition of strain energy density in phase field approach to fracture accounting for orthotropic materials

To account for the tension-compression asymmetry in the phase field approach to fracture, this MR implements a decomposition of constitutive relations into crack-driving and persistent portions, specifically designed for materials with anisotropic/orthotropic behavior. Two split models, namely, volumetric-deviatoric and no-tension are added in the MaterialLib/SolidModels for this purpose. Further extension of no-tension to a three-dimensional setting will be subject of a subsequent MR. Also, a c_test is added for this benchmark.
